Soup, cream of mushroom, canned, condensed, reduced sodium Nutrition Facts

Summary: 52 calories per 100 g serving. Net carbs: 7.5 g (total carbs 8.1 g – fiber 0.6 g) – not keto friendly. Contains 1.2 g protein and 1.7 g fat.

Cream of mushroom soup in the canned, condensed, reduced-sodium style is a simple, comforting pantry staple. Each serving has 52 calories, making it a light option.

It contains 1.7g fat, 8.1g carbs, and 1.2g protein per serving. The 0.6g fiber is modest, so it isn’t especially filling.

With 2.1g sugar per serving, it’s not very sweet. It works well as a quick soup base or an easy side.
